Why These Are the Top Honda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Grand Valley

** The Honda repair market in and around Grand Valley, PA, is characteristic of a rural and small-town region. There are no dealerships within the immediate borough, necessitating travel to nearby towns like Union City, Titusville, or Erie for specialized service. The market competition is moderate, with a mix of dedicated Japanese import specialists and long-standing general repair shops that have developed Honda expertise over decades. The average quality of service is high among the top-rated shops, as they rely heavily on local reputation and word-of-mouth. Pricing is generally competitive and often more affordable than dealership rates in larger metro areas, with labor rates typically ranging from $90-$130 per hour. For highly complex issues (e.g., advanced hybrid system repairs or performance tuning), residents may need to travel to the Erie area for the most specialized service centers.

What are the most common Honda repair issues you see in Grand Valley, PA, due to local driving conditions?

Given our rural roads and seasonal temperature swings, we frequently see suspension wear (struts, control arms) from potholes and uneven terrain, along with battery and starting issues exacerbated by cold winters. Honda models like the CR-V and Civic also commonly need attention for worn CV joints and brakes due to the hilly landscape.

When should I seek service for my Honda's check engine light around Grand Valley?

You should seek diagnostics imm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ire that could damage the catalytic converter, especially important given our distance from major repair centers. If it's solid, schedule an appointment promptly, as issues like faulty oxygen sensors can reduce fuel efficiency on our longer rural commutes.

What local seasonal maintenance should Honda owners in Grand Valley prioritize?

Before winter, a thorough battery test and inspection of tires, wipers, and coolant are crucial for safe travel on routes like Route 27. In spring, a undercarriage check for rust from road salt and a suspension inspection for pothole damage are highly recommended to maintain your Honda's reliability.
